Understanding the Difference: Periodontist vs. Dentist

Both general dentists and periodontists play vital roles in oral health, but their areas of expertise differ. A general dentist handles routine dental care, including cleanings, fillings, and preventive education. In contrast, a periodontist undergoes additional training beyond dental school, specializing in the prevention, diagnosis, and treatment of periodontal disease and the placement of dental implants. This specialized training equips them to manage complex cases that go beyond the scope of general dentistry.

 

Advanced Gum Disease Treatment

While general dentists can treat early stages of gum disease, a periodontics specialist in Marlborough is equipped to handle more advanced cases. Conditions such as periodontitis, characterized by deep gum pockets and bone loss, require specialized care. Periodontists perform procedures like scaling and root planing to remove tartar and bacteria from beneath the gum line, and may also perform surgical interventions to restore gum health.

 

Dental Implant Placement

Dental implants are a standard solution for replacing missing teeth. While general dentists may place implants in straightforward cases, a periodontist is often preferred for complex situations. Their advanced training allows them to assess bone density and structure, perform necessary bone grafts, and place implants with precision, ensuring long-term success.

 

Gum Grafting and Recession Repair

Gum recession can expose tooth roots, leading to sensitivity and potential tooth loss. A periodontics specialist in Marlborough can perform gum grafting procedures to restore lost gum tissue. This involves taking tissue from another part of your mouth or using donor tissue to cover exposed areas, improving both function and aesthetics.

 

Bone Grafting for Tooth Support

When bone loss occurs due to periodontal disease or trauma, it can compromise the stability of teeth. A periodontist can perform bone grafting procedures to rebuild and strengthen the jawbone, providing a solid foundation for dental implants and preserving natural teeth.
